Mac Book Air (MBA) の初期設定メモ書き Part2
(2015.10.24, Yosemite)
Java の開発環境を導入し、GitHub へ接続できるようにしました
メモ書き Part1: Mac Book Air (MBA) の初期設定メモ書き Part1
JDK
- jdk のインストール
brew cask をインストールして、java8, java7 をインストール
Brewで楽々Javaバージョン切り替え などを参考にした
brew update
brew install caskroom/cask/brew-cask
brew cask install java
brew cask install caskroom/versions/java7
- java のバージョン切り替え方法
export JAVA_HOME=`/usr/libexec/java_home -v 1.7`
export JAVA_HOME=`/usr/libexec/java_home -v 1.8`
IntelliJ IDEA
-
Install
インストール & 起動 -> Dock のアイコンを右クリック
-> Options -> Keep in Dock
IntelliJ IDEA をインストールして、起動するためのコマンド
brew cask install intellij-idea-ce
open /opt/homebrew-cask/Caskroom/intellij-idea-ce/14.1.5/IntelliJ\ IDEA\ 14\ CE.app
-
初期設定
Darcula -> I've never used IDEA -> Next
-> Scala, IdeaVim を Install & enabled
-> Start using IntelliJ IDEA
-> Do you want to enable repeating keys in mac os x on press and hold? -> yes -
Font サイズを少し大きくした
IntelliJ IDEA -> Preferences -> Editor -> Colors & Fonts -> Font -> Save As...
-> 適当に Darcula1 とか名前を付けて save -> Monaco 14pt -> Apply -
JDK の指定など
Create New Project -> Java -> Project SDK -> New -> JDK
-> Home となっている場所を JavaVirtualMachines に変更
-> jdk1.8.0_66.jdk (or jdk1.7.0_79.jdk) を選択 -> Choose
-> "Test" とか適当なプロジェクト名を付けて作成
-> System.out.println("Hello world!"); が動くかチェックした
-> 作成したプロジェクトを削除した(起動時のプロジェクト選択画面で "Delete")
->rm -r ~/IdeaProjects/Test/
で ~/IdeaProjects 配下も削除した
GitHub
- 鍵の作成、公開鍵をクリップボードにコピー
以下のコマンドを Terminal に入力
cd ~/.ssh
ssh-keygen -t rsa -b 2048 -f github_key -C username@mba
cat github_key.pub | pbcopy
- GitHub に登録
GitHub にログイン -> 右上のマーク -> Setting -> Personal Setting
-> SSH keys -> Add SSH key -> タイトルを適当に付け、Key に公開鍵をペースト
-> Add key -> Password の入力
- ~/.ssh/config の編集
Terminal で、vim ~/.ssh/config
として、以下のように編集
HOST github
HOSTNAME github.com
USER git
IDENTITYFILE ~/.ssh/github_key
- git clone
以下のコマンドを Terminal で入力して、作成途中のプロジェクトを git clone
した
cd ~/Desktop
mkdir GitHubProjects
cd !$
git clone github:/username/projectname.git